Today's construction sector demands materials that combine aesthetic appeal, structural integrity, and environmental sustainability. Traditional materials like natural stone and concrete remain popular, but innovative solutions such as Modified Clay Materials (MCM) are transforming how architects and builders approach interior and exterior applications. These advanced materials offer the visual beauty of natural stone with enhanced flexibility, lighter weight, and easier installation.

Quality building materials serve diverse applications across residential, commercial, and institutional projects. Exterior wall cladding panels have become particularly popular for modern architecture, offering designers the ability to create striking facades without the weight and cost of traditional stone installation.
In commercial developments such as hotels, shopping centers, and office buildings, decorative panels provide cost-effective ways to achieve premium aesthetics. The flexibility of modern materials allows curved installations, complex patterns, and rapid renovation of existing structures with minimal structural modifications.
Residential applications range from feature walls in living spaces to complete exterior transformations. The lighter weight of MCM-based products compared to natural stone simplifies installation on various substrates, reducing both labor costs and construction timelines.
Environmental considerations are increasingly central to construction material selection. Forward-thinking building materials manufacturing companies are developing products that support green building certifications and reduce environmental impact throughout the product lifecycle.
Modified clay materials exemplify this trend, utilizing abundant natural resources in manufacturing processes that consume less energy than traditional ceramic firing. The durability and low maintenance requirements of quality materials also contribute to reduced lifecycle environmental impact, as surfaces require fewer replacements and repairs over time.
